About Melissa Danesh
Melissa Danesh is a scholar working on Dermatology, Immunology, Oncology, Epidemiology and Surgery, having authored 34 papers that have together received 397 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Psoriasis: Treatment and Pathogenesis (8 papers), Dermatology and Skin Diseases (6 papers), Nonmelanoma Skin Cancer Studies (4 papers), Contact Dermatitis and Allergies (3 papers), Cutaneous lymphoproliferative disorders research (3 papers), Allergic Rhinitis and Sensitization (2 papers), Cutaneous Melanoma Detection and Management (2 papers) and Pharmaceutical studies and practices (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Dermatology (203 citations), Immunology (121 citations), Immunology and Allergy (29 citations), Complementary and Manual Therapy (6 citations) and Rheumatology (34 citations). Melissa Danesh has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Australia and India. Frequent co-authors include John Koo, Kourosh Beroukhim, Catherine Nguyen, Jenny E. Murase, Argentina Leon, Wilson Liao, Ladan Afifi, Di Yan, Richard Ahn and Benjamin Farahnik.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Academy of Dermatology, Journal of Dermatological Treatment, Clinics in Dermatology, Dermatologic Surgery and Dermatology and Therapy.
